DOVER — Planning Board continues ADU review, requires plan revisions. Vice Chair Jody Shue and the Board heard from applicant Iva Hayes regarding a proposed 538-square-foot detached accessory dwelling unit at 18 Meadowbrook Road, voting 3-0 to continue the preliminary site plan review to March 23, 2026. The Board required Hayes to obtain revised plans from her surveyor removing restrictive notes limiting the survey's use to septic design purposes, and to submit dated, scaled elevations and floor plans identifying the preparer with full contact information.
The Board also canceled its March 9 meeting to allow Vice Chair Shue and Town Planner Melissa SantucciRozzi to present the Planning Board's FY2027 budget and zoning articles to the Warrant Committee on February 25.
